Nicotinamide Riboside: The New Darling of Anti-Aging Research

Nicotinamide Riboside (NR) has garnered significant attention in the scientific community for its potential to promote healthy aging. This nucleotide derivative is a precursor to NAD+ (nicotinamide adenine dinucleotide) and plays a critical role in cellular metabolism and energy production.

NAD+ is an essential coenzyme for various cellular processes, from gene expression and DNA repair to mitochondrial function. As NAD+ levels decline with age, our cellular efficiency decreases and we become more susceptible to age-related diseases.

With its unique mechanism of action and promising results, NR has become a focal point in anti-aging research.1 Researchers aim to boost NAD+ levels through NR supplementation, enhancing cellular function and potentially mitigating the effects of aging.

The Cutting-Edge Science Behind NR’s Anti-Aging Effects

Nicotinamide Riboside’s anti-aging effects are rooted in its ability to modulate key molecular pathways. By targeting these key pathways, NR has the potential to promote healthspan and mitigate the effects of aging at a cellular level.

One of the primary mechanisms by which NR exerts its effects is activating sirtuins, a family of proteins that play a critical role in promoting cellular health and maintaining genomic stability. NR boosts NAD+ levels, which activates SIRT1, a sirtuin that helps promote mitochondrial biogenesis, suppresses inflammation, and enhances DNA repair.

NR has also been found to influence mTOR (Mammalian target of rapamycin), a crucial autophagy and cellular metabolism regulator. Autophagy is essential for preventing the accumulation of toxic waste products in our cells and maintaining cellular homeostasis.

It has also been shown to induce epigenetic modifications and alter gene expression patterns that result in changes in cellular behavior, promoting healthy aging. Ongoing research continues to decode the complex interplay between NR, NAD+, and these molecular pathways.2

How NR is Changing the Face of Aging Research

Nicotinamide Riboside is revolutionizing our understanding of healthy aging and longevity. Here are the latest NR and NR supplementation research findings in recent years.

What is really known about the effects of nicotinamide riboside supplementation in humans

This review critically evaluates 25 NR supplementation clinical studies, assessing its benefits versus overstated claims. The findings show that NR has metabolic promise in preclinical studies and the potential to reduce inflammation and support treatment for severe diseases.

The results also demonstrate how long-term NR supplementation increases NAD+ levels, suggesting its potential as an anti-aging therapy.3 While more human trials are needed, this research aims to clarify NR’s impact and guide future research.

Nicotinamide Riboside, a Promising Vitamin B3 Derivative for Healthy Aging and Longevity: Current Research and Perspectives

NR was studied for its role in aging and disease prevention as a precursor to NAD+. While it shows promise as a supplement for metabolic health and longevity, NR’s instability during production and storage presents challenges.

These findings suggest a form of NR that offers higher stability without altering its pharmacological effects. This review highlights the benefits of NR supplementation, the hurdles in its delivery, and how a different form might enhance its practical use.4

Emerging Role of Nicotinamide Riboside in Health and Diseases

This review highlights NR as a powerful NAD+ precursor with substantial safety and efficacy profiles.5 Its role in NAD+ biosynthesis, its synthesis methods, and its impact on health were explored.

As a form of vitamin B3, NR is orally bioavailable and has shown promise in improving mitochondrial function, reducing inflammation in aged human skeletal muscle, and protecting against conditions like diabetes, hearing loss, and neurodegeneration.

Equilibrative Nucleoside Transporters Mediate the Import of Nicotinamide Riboside and Nicotinic Acid Riboside into Human Cells

This research investigates how NR enters human cells to restore physiological functions weakened by aging and disease.6 The study identifies members of the ENT (equilibrative nucleoside transporter) family as key to nicotinamide riboside uptake.

Additionally, the researchers explored the transport and metabolism of nicotinic acid riboside (NAR), a lesser-known NAD+ precursor and form of NR that boosts NAD+ levels following a slightly different metabolic pathway than NR.

While NR is often preferred due to its superior bioavailability, NAR offers new insights into NR’s potential applications in biomedicine.

Nicotinamide Riboside: The Anti-Aging Breakthrough

The anti-aging scientific community continues to explore NAD+ boosters, from NR to NMN and NMNR, discovering new therapeutic applications and health benefits to help people live better, healthier lives.

While preclinical studies suggest nicotinamide riboside can help protect against neurodegeneration, metabolic decline, and other aging-related conditions, human trials have shown mixed results. However, NR’s ability to support cellular function remains promising.

Looking ahead:

  • More extensive clinical trials are needed to fully understand NR’s long-term impact on disease prevention and age-related declineing.
  • Further studies into NR’s therapeutic applications and potential to enhance human healthspan are underway.
  • Researchers continue to explore ways to enhance NR’s bioavailability and stability to improve its effectiveness.
